В 1935 г. поступил на механико-математический факультет МГУ, который окончил в 1940 г. Обучался в аспирантуре НИИ математики Московского университета (1944-1947).
Кандидат физико-математических наук (1947), тема диссертации: «Проекционные спектры бикомпактных пространств» (научный руководитель - П. С. Александров). Доктор физико-математических наук (1954), тема диссертации: «Вопросы решения математических задач с большим числом операций».
Заслуженный деятель науки Российской Федерации (1999). Почетный член РАЕН (1991). Заслуженный профессор Московского государственного университета (1994). Дважды лауреат Государственной премии СССР (1955, 1978). Награжден орденами Ленина (1990), Трудового Красного Знамени (1956, 1983), «Знак Почета» (1961), медалью «За Победу над Германией» (1945) и юбилейными медалями.
В 1940-1947 гг. преподаватель кафедры математики Артиллерийской академии им. Ф. Э. Дзержинского. После окончания аспирантуры в 1947 г. и защиты кандидатской диссертации был направлен на вновь созданный физико-технический факультет Московского университета (преобразованный в 1951 г. в Московский физико-технический институт МФТИ), где проработал на кафедре математики в должностях старшего преподавателя, доцента, профессора вплоть до 1954/55 учебного года.
С 1955 г. М. Р. Шура-Бура снова преподает в Московском университете: профессор кафедры вычислительной математики механико-математического факультета (1955-1970); заведующий кафедрой системного программирования (1970-1993), профессор кафедры системного программирования (с 1994) факультета вычислительной математики и кибернетики.
Параллельно с преподаванием М. Р. Шура-Бура занимался проблемами вычислительной математики, с которыми столкнулся еще во время работы в Артиллерийской академии, сотрудничая с кафедрой внешней баллистики. В 1947-1948 гг. М. Р. Шура-Бура принял участие в работах отдела приближенных вычислений Математического института им. В. А. Стеклова АН СССР. В 1948 году вместе со своим отделом перешел во вновь организованный Институт точной механики и вычислительной техники АН СССР. В 1952 г. защитил диссертацию на соискание ученой степени доктора физико-математических наук.
В 1953 г. М. Р. Шура-Бура начал работать в Отделении прикладной математики Математического института им. В. А. Стеклова, созданном М. В. Келдышем и преобразованном затем в Институт прикладной математики АН СССР (ныне ИПМ РАН им. М. В. Келдыша), где возглавил отдел автоматизации программирования. Первым результатом работы отдела программирования ИПМ, которым руководил М. Р. Шура-Бура, было создание на ЭВМ «Стрела» программ для расчета энергии ядерных взрывов (1953-1955). Параметры ЭВМ того времени требовали от программистов виртуозного умения и оригинальных находок в организации отладки программ и счета. В 1955 г. М. Р. Шура-Бура за вклад в создание ядерного оружия в СССР был удостоен Государственной премии СССР.
В середине 1950-х гг. отдел программирования был привлечен М. В. Келдышем к расчетам траекторий искусственных спутников Земли (ИСЗ). Разработанные отделом программы для ЭВМ «Стрела», а затем М 20, обеспечивали круглосуточный режим обработки траекторных ИСЗ. Они использовались с 1957 г. при запуске ИСЗ, полете Ю. А. Гагарина в 1961 г. и затем в течение последующих 10 лет.
М. Р. Шура-Бура соавтор архитектуры известной ЭВМ М 20, архитектуры, воплощенной впоследствии в нескольких сериях полупроводниковых отечественных ЭВМ. М. Р. Шура-Бура руководитель создания ее базового программного обеспечения и автор знаменитой в свое время системы ИС 2. Работы отдела М. Р. Шура-Бура по языкам и системам программирования были начаты еще в 1950-х гг. с использованием операторного программирования на основе теории схем программ А. А. Ляпунова. В 1963 г. под руководством М. Р. Шура-Бура был создан первый транслятор с языка АЛГОЛ 60 для ЭВМ М 20 транслятор ТА-2 с полной версии языка АЛГОЛ 60. За ним последовали системы программирования для БЭСМ 6 и других ЭВМ.
М. Р. Шура-Бура был научным руководителем разработки программного обеспечения ЕС ЭВМ. В 1978 г. за выполнение этой работы был удостоен Государственной премии СССР. В 1980-х гг. М. Р. Шура-Бура успешно решил казавшуюся поначалу тупиковой проблему своевременного создания системного и прикладного программного обеспечения для космического челнока «Буран». За вклад в создание «Бурана» награжден орденом Ленина. До настоящего времени М. Р. Шура-Бура руководит разработкой прикладных систем наземной диагностики сложных технических комплексов в интересах космических исследований.
М.Р. Шура Бура глава ведущей научной школы в области программирования. Руководит научно-исследовательским семинаром по автоматизации программирования (с 1956). Читал основные и специальные курсы по современным проблемам программирования. Подготовил более 30 кандидатов и 8 докторов наук.
Автор свыше 70 научных работ, монографий и учебников, в том числе соавтор (вместе с Л.А. Люстерником, А.А. Абрамовым, В.И. Шестаковым) первой в Советском Союзе монографии по программированию «Решение математических задач на автоматических цифровых машинах. Программирование для быстродействующих электронных счетных машин» (М.: изд. АН СССР, 1952), по которой училось первое поколение советских программистов. Среди других публикаций:
Система интерпретации ИС-2 // В сб.: Библиотека стандартных программ - М.: ЦБТИ, 1961;
The Early Development of Programming in the USSR // В сб.: A history of Computing in the Twentieth Century - Ас. Press, 1980 (соавт. Ершов А. П.).
О Михаиле Романовиче Шура-Бура:
К 90-летию со дня рождения Михаила Романовича Шура-Буры. ВЕСТН. МОСК.УН ТА. СЕР.15. ВЫЧИСЛ. МАТЕМ. И КИБЕРН. 2008. ? 4, стр. 3-4
Раздел Витруального компьютерного музея, посвященный М. Р. Шура-Бура www.computer-museum.ru/galglory/shurabur0.htm
Памяти МИХАИЛА РОМАНОВИЧА ШУРА-БУРА (1918-2008). ВЕСТН. МОСК.УН ТА. СЕР.15. ВЫЧИСЛ. МАТЕМ. И КИБЕРН. 2009. ? 1, стр.. 50-51
Памяти Михаила Романовича Шура-Бура (21.10.1918-14.12.2008). Программирование, ? 1, 2009, стр. 3.
|